Cloudron makes it easy to run web apps like WordPress, Nextcloud, GitLab on your server. Find out more or install now.


Skip to content
  • Categories
  • Recent
  • Tags
  • Popular
  • Bookmarks
  • Search
Skins
  • Light
  • Brite
  • Cerulean
  • Cosmo
  • Flatly
  • Journal
  • Litera
  • Lumen
  • Lux
  • Materia
  • Minty
  • Morph
  • Pulse
  • Sandstone
  • Simplex
  • Sketchy
  • Spacelab
  • United
  • Yeti
  • Zephyr
  • Dark
  • Cyborg
  • Darkly
  • Quartz
  • Slate
  • Solar
  • Superhero
  • Vapor

  • Default (No Skin)
  • No Skin
Collapse
Brand Logo

Cloudron Forum

Apps | Demo | Docs | Install
  1. Cloudron Forum
  2. Humhub
  3. Feedback/Bug Report: HumHub Package – Missing Default Fields breaking Modules & LDAP Issues

Feedback/Bug Report: HumHub Package – Missing Default Fields breaking Modules & LDAP Issues

Scheduled Pinned Locked Moved Humhub
6 Posts 4 Posters 41 Views 4 Watching
  • Oldest to Newest
  • Newest to Oldest
  • Most Votes
Reply
  • Reply as topic
Log in to reply
This topic has been deleted. Only users with topic management privileges can see it.
  • apesorgukA Offline
    apesorgukA Offline
    apesorguk
    wrote last edited by
    #1

    Hi Cloudron Team,

    We wanted to provide some detailed feedback regarding the current HumHub package on Cloudron. We recently conducted a side-by-side test, installing HumHub on Cloudron and simultaneously on a standard Plesk server.

    We encountered several significant issues with the Cloudron package that seem to stem from how the default schema/profile fields are handled compared to a standard installation.

    Here are the specific findings:

    1. Stripped Default Profile Fields & Broken Modules

    It appears the Cloudron package removes standard default profile fields that usually ship with HumHub. This causes immediate issues with popular Marketplace Modules:

    • Birthday Module: Because the DOB (Date of Birth) field was removed/missing in the Cloudron package, installing this module causes an Internal Error immediately.

    • Maps Module: Similarly, the Address fields are missing, causing the Maps module to throw an Internal Error upon installation.

    2. Manual Field Restoration & Persistence of Errors

    To attempt a fix, we manually re-added the missing fields to the Cloudron instance by cross-referencing our working Plesk installation (since documentation on the specific default fields was hard to find).

    • Even after manually recreating the missing fields to match the standard schema, we continued to experience Internal Errors with various other modules.

    • This suggests the issue might go deeper than just the visible profile fields in the UI.

    3. LDAP Field Locking (Edit Issues)

    We encountered a separate issue regarding the Cloudron LDAP integration:

    • When adding new profile fields, the LDAP setup seems to aggressively lock these fields for new users.

    • Neither the user nor the Admin can edit these fields; they appear "greyed out" and unclickable in the UI, even though permissions should allow for editing. We could not determine the root cause of this locking behavior.

    Comparison with Standard (Plesk) Install

    To verify these weren't upstream HumHub bugs, we tested the exact same scenarios on our Plesk installation:

    • We had zero issues with module installations.

    • All default fields were present out-of-the-box.

    • Modules that crashed on Cloudron (Birthday, Maps) worked perfectly on Plesk.

    Current Workaround & LDAP Latency

    Due to the stability of the modules on the standard install, we have decided to stick with the Plesk installation for the application itself, but we are using Cloudron as the LDAP provider for user management.

    However, we have noticed a performance bottleneck here:

    • Authentication communication between the external Plesk HumHub and Cloudron's LDAP service is very slow.

    • Logins can take up to one minute to process.

    We hope this feedback helps in refining the HumHub package, specifically regarding the retention of default profile fields to ensure compatibility with Marketplace modules.

    Thanks!

    1 Reply Last reply
    0
    • jdaviescoatesJ Offline
      jdaviescoatesJ Offline
      jdaviescoates
      wrote last edited by
      #2

      This should be in the HumHub category. Also, it seems to be the same issue as this: https://forum.cloudron.io/post/114930

      I use Cloudron with Gandi & Hetzner

      apesorgukA 1 Reply Last reply
      0
      • J joseph moved this topic from Discuss
      • jdaviescoatesJ jdaviescoates

        This should be in the HumHub category. Also, it seems to be the same issue as this: https://forum.cloudron.io/post/114930

        apesorgukA Offline
        apesorgukA Offline
        apesorguk
        wrote last edited by
        #3

        @jdaviescoates

        Let's just admit to it, the default fields all need to be reinstated so that modules and HumHub in general work as intended.

        Not a problem for us as we get a free license from Plesk and Grants from Akamai.

        1 Reply Last reply
        0
        • jamesJ Offline
          jamesJ Offline
          james
          Staff
          wrote last edited by james
          #4

          Hello @apesorguk

          What version of the Humhub app did you test on what Cloudron version?
          I have just tested this on the https://my.demo.cloudron.io server and have the fields and modules:

          6579fb3a-a040-4ed1-8a33-4b4e7026b910-image.png

          a15c34a6-16c7-48e3-903a-7760ab6d31af-image.png

          But I noticed something that might could lead to such issues.
          The first startup comes up as "healthy" / "running" to fast. The app was still setting up the modules and such, but the dashboard displayed "running" already.
          Maybe, when interacting / interrupting Humhub in this semi done state, this might cause some of the issues you mentioned above.

          1 Reply Last reply
          0
          • apesorgukA Offline
            apesorgukA Offline
            apesorguk
            wrote last edited by apesorguk
            #5

            I am not sure what version we had; we gave up after 3-4 errors. I can say it was about 6-7 months ago, even though we tried a few times before the 7 months, and we had the problem then. The only fields we had were first name, last name; the communication tab was not even there.

            1 Reply Last reply
            0
            • J Offline
              J Offline
              joseph
              Staff
              wrote last edited by
              #6

              The setup issue was fixed on Dec 7 2025 with package v1.8.5

              1 Reply Last reply
              0
              Reply
              • Reply as topic
              Log in to reply
              • Oldest to Newest
              • Newest to Oldest
              • Most Votes


              • Login

              • Don't have an account? Register

              • Login or register to search.
              • First post
                Last post
              0
              • Categories
              • Recent
              • Tags
              • Popular
              • Bookmarks
              • Search